Why is it important to behold Jesus as the Lamb of God?

Answered in 1 source

Beholding Jesus as the Lamb of God is crucial for understanding our salvation and the depth of God's love.

To behold Jesus as the Lamb of God is to acknowledge the core of Christian faith, as it embodies both His sacrificial love and His ongoing role in our lives. In John 1:36, we are invited to look to Jesus for salvation, emphasizing the personal relationship we are called to maintain with Him. This act of beholding motivates believers to seek His presence continuously, allowing that relationship to transform our hearts and desires. As Robert Hawker outlines, it is through this constant gaze upon Christ that we find peace, purpose, and hope, both now and for eternity.
Scripture References: John 1:36
